## Tuning retries

Fennwick delivers webhooks with exponential backoff and jitter. Your plugin endpoint must return 2xx within the timeout or the attempt counts as failed. After the max attempt count, the event is parked in the dead-letter queue and requires manual replay. Do not rely on delivery order across retries. Override defaults only if your endpoint is consistently slow; aggressive values get throttled platform-wide. Current defaults are listed below.

tuning constants:
RATE_LIMITS = {
    "wenwyn": 1,
    "zorix": 10,
    "oliix": 2,
    "holael": 10,
}

Wiki (Managers Only) — Currency Hedging Decision, Oreland Maritime

Prepared for the board: following volatility in our two principal trading currencies, treasury has adopted a layered hedging programme covering 75% of forecast receivables over rolling twelve-month horizons, using forwards and a small options overlay. The policy caps unhedged exposure at 10% of revenue and mandates quarterly board review of effectiveness. The broader planning assumptions behind this decision are recorded in the note below.

confidential, kagep-kahof: Druokax Systems plans to lower the Ulaath list price by 53 percent in March.

**Ticket: Signature check failing on import wizard build**

The Gristmark CSV import wizard v4.2.1 fails verification on install. Affects all customers pulling from the update channel since last night. Root cause: build was signed with the rotated-out key. Fix: re-sign and republish; support should tell customers to retry after the new build lands. No data risk. For manual verification of the re-signed package, use the current public key below.

rollout seal: bky9_PeXH1fTLY

Visitor policy — Dunmore Court facilities

Visitors arriving by bicycle may use the west bike cage only when accompanied by a member of staff; the cage is not covered by visitor passes. Vehicle visitors must be pre-registered so the parking gates recognise the booking, and the desk should confirm each arrival against the day sheet. Should the gate barrier fail to lift for a registered visitor, staff may raise it manually with the code below.

staff pass of kawip-hawef = bdg-QLP-2